Job Summary
We are looking for an experienced Quantity Surveyor to join our team in Muscat, Oman. The successful candidate will be responsible for managing project costs from estimation through to final accounts, ensuring projects are delivered on time, within budget, and in compliance with Omani construction laws, FIDIC contracts, and client specifications.
Ideal applicants will have strong experience in Oman or GCC-based construction projects, and a solid understanding of local market rates, regulations, and construction practices.
Key Responsibilities
- Prepare cost estimates, budgets, and BOQs from architectural and engineering drawings.
- Conduct feasibility studies, cost planning, and track budget vs. actual progress.
- Manage tenders, contract documentation, subcontractor negotiations, and procurement processes.
- Perform cost analysis, handle variations and claims, and issue interim payment certifications.
- Ensure full compliance with Omani labor laws, building codes, and FIDIC contractual terms.
- Collaborate with project managers, consultants, and clients on all financial and contractual matters.
- Prepare final accounts and close-out documentation, maintaining detailed cost records.
Qualifications
- Bachelor's Degree in Quantity Surveying, Civil Engineering, or related field.
- 4 to 6 years of relevant experience in construction or contracting.
- GCC or Oman project experience is highly preferred.
- Strong knowledge of Omani building codes, regulatory standards, and local market rates.
- Experience working with FIDIC contracts and local contract law.
- Familiar with ISO 9001, ISO 45001, and ISO 14001 standards.
- Proficiency in MS Excel, AutoCAD, and QS software like Candy or CostX.
- Excellent commercial awareness, negotiation skills, and reporting ability.
Key Skills
- Cost estimation & planning for infrastructure, civil, and building projects
- BOQ preparation, tendering, and procurement
- Contract administration, claims, and variation management
- Budget monitoring, cost control, and risk analysis
- Deep understanding of Oman's construction market and supplier ecosystem
